on, off, then on again

I remember hearing of someone who painted 27 times on one piece of Wallis paper by washing the pastel off and starting again. I certainly hope I can become content with this piece of Wallis long before that number.

This painting was originally posted 1/23/09 both as the foundation and finished painting, "Winter Riverwalk." Since then, it has been sitting in my studio, bugging me. About a month ago I washed it off and today I began again. As in my post of 1/26/08, I turned it upside down for a fresh start. For now, I'm OK with this one. We'll see how long it lasts. See the upside down foundation below. This time I'm calling it "Charmed."
